38 Boone County residents 80 or older test positive for COVID-19

Webp pharma

As of June 2, there have been 38 Boone County residents 80 years of age and older who have tested positive for COVID-19, according to numbers being reported to the Illinois Department of Public Health.

There have been 228 residents 80 and older in the county who had been tested, meaning that 16 percent of those tested have the coronavirus. Through June 2, there have been 476 confirmed COVID-19 cases and 17 deaths from the coronavirus in Boone County.

Illinois gathers all of its COVID-19 data from across the state electronically. The reported cases and deaths will fluctuate as additional info is gathered. Chicago was home to one of the first known cases of COVID-19 in the US, as well as it's transmission.
